ZIP 95119 and ZIP 95123 are ZIP Code areas in California.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
ZIP 95123 has the higher population (70,279 vs 10,449 in ZIP 95119). ZIP 95119 has the higher median household income ($164,129 vs $136,364 in ZIP 95123). ZIP 95119 has the higher median home value ($1,176,100 vs $1,108,100 in ZIP 95123).
